    Questions/Time Stamps
    6:50 How did we end up with fauna like the Kopion and Marok instead of anything we've previously seen before?
    9:08 Economy updates?
    14:48 Will there be a wipe in 3.23?
    16:04 What should players expect in terms of gameplay with the reputation hostility feature card committed to the 3.23 roadmap?
    17:53 Sniper glint, WTF man?
    20:45 Why can we scan other players ships, but not our own?
    21:20 Master modes? Why was it made?
    28:00 Performance issues, what's the deal?
    31:05 How concerned are you with avoiding another 3.18?
    38:27 With 3.23 being the biggest patch yet, was it too much?
    42:25 Current state? How's it going? (Cargo elevators, personal persistent hangers and freight elevators)
    44:56 Once personal persistent hangers come out, will our landing zone remain the same as what players choose when 3.23 drops?
    47:57 How do you see arena commander?
    50:10 What is the go no go process like today?
    53:02 Bed loggings future?
    54:01 Currently it is very hard to be a bad guy in Star Citizen, what's the future hold for the bad guys?
    57:34 What place is there for a solo player in Star Citizen?
    1:00:04 Hey JJ, why the F don't we have night vision? WTF MAN!

    1:02:12 That is exactly what night vision is. It amplifies ambient light, well military versions anyway. You don't want to project light, even on the infra red spectrum because the enemy can see it if they have night vision.

    • @brianorca
      @brianorca 4 месяца назад +8

      Yes and no. Some night vision amplifies ambient light, but others display other parts of the non-visible spectrum such as infrared. Both types are in use for military combat with various hardware.
      It's true than only the really cheap security cameras use a flood of infrared illumination. This is not the thing you want for any combat situation.

      Most military night-sights use IR, usually with a monochrome display. Some use amplified ambient light. Many use both. Problem from a game POV is that each spectrum band is a separate graphics render, and so is heavy on the resources.

    • @yohanzeta
      @yohanzeta 4 месяца назад

      No one here knows what they’re talking about. (except maybe stormwolf) About halfway through my latest short is me using night vision with IR lasers and illuminators through a laser aiming module.
      Night Vision devices amplify light. Some are more capable than others to the point where they can make SWIR (short wave infrared) but the most part IR Illumination is used in conjunction with Night Vision to aid with illumination, particularly into places with insufficient ambient light.
      In general, these devices are used by both infantry and aviators. Considering how far this game is into the future, there really ought to be some solution for low light/no-light circumstances.
